def __init__(self, conn): super().__init__(conn) receiver_details = ReceiverDetails() def send_receiver_info(*args): receiver_info = receiver_details.__dict__() self.write_receiver_details(receiver_info) self._detailsSubscription = receiver_details.wire(send_receiver_info) send_receiver_info()
def header_variables(self): variables = {"document_root": self.get_document_root()} variables.update(ReceiverDetails().__dict__()) return variables
def receiverDetails(self): receiver_details = ReceiverDetails() data = json.dumps(receiver_details.__dict__()) self.send_response(data, content_type="application/json")